Summary

This observational study follows adults with morbid obesity who undergo bariatric surgery to see if substantial weight loss changes the alignment of their hips, knees, and ankles. Researchers measure leg alignment using standing X-rays before surgery and at 3, 6, and 12 months after. The goal is to understand how the weight-bearing system of the lower limbs responds to major weight loss, which may inform future research on joint health and arthritis.

Who is studied

Adults with morbid obesity undergoing bariatric surgery as part of routine clinical care will be prospectively enrolled and followed. Lower-extremity coronal alignment and mechanical-axis parameters will be evaluated using standardized standing full-length lower-extremity radiographs obtained before surgery and at approximately 3, 6, and 12 months after surgery. Serial measurements will be used to evaluate longitudinal changes in hip-knee-ankle alignment and related femoral, tibial, and knee joint-line parameters during postoperative weight loss.

Inclusion Criteria: * Adults aged 18 years or older. * Patients with morbid obesity who are scheduled to undergo bariatric surgery according to routine clinical indications. * Ability to stand independently for standardized weight-bearing lower-extremity radiographic assessment. * Availability of an appropriate preoperative standing full-length lower-extremity radiograph allowing assessment of the hip, knee, and ankle centers. * Planned postoperative clinical and radiographic follow-up at approximately 3, 6, and 12 months. * Ability and willingness to participate in the prospective follow-up protocol. Exclusion Criteria: * Previous lower-extremity corrective osteotomy, joint arthroplasty, or major reconstructive surgery that substantially alters mechanical alignment. * Previous fracture malunion or major skeletal deformity involving the pelvis, femur, tibia, knee, or ankle that prevents representative mechanical-axis assessment. * Neurological or neuromuscular disorders substantially affecting standing lower-extremity alignment. * Inability to obtain technically adequate standardized standing full-length lower-extremity radiographs. * Pregnancy at a time when radiographic assessment would otherwise be required. * Major lower-extremity trauma or surgery occurring during follow-up that may independently alter mechanical alignment. * Incomplete or unavailable radiographic data required for longitudinal analysis.
